Redeeming a code on Roblox is a straightforward process that requires just a few steps. To get started, make sure you have a valid Roblox account and a gift card or promo code that you want to redeem. Next, head to the Roblox website and navigate to the Redeem Code option. Once you’re there, simply enter your code, and if it’s valid, you’ll receive the corresponding in-game item or currency.

That’s it – it’s as simple as that!

Invalid Codes

Invalid Roblox codes are a common issue that can be frustrating. These codes are either expired, incorrect, or have been entered twice. In such cases, users should first check if the code has expired or is no longer valid for redemption. If the code is valid, the user should try re-entering it carefully to ensure that there are no typos or formatting errors.

If the issue persists, contact Roblox support for assistance.

  • Codes can become invalid if they have been redeemed previously or have expired.
  • Ensure that you enter the code correctly, without typos or formatting errors.
  • Contact Roblox support if you continue to experience issues.

Staying Safe While Redeeming Codes on the Roblox Website

To avoid potential risks associated with redeeming codes, follow these essential guidelines:

  •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) to add an extra layer of security to your account.
  • Never share your login credentials with anyone.
  • Use a complex and unique password for your Roblox account.
  • Regularly monitor your account activity for suspicious behavior.
  • Avoid clicking on suspicious links or downloading attachments from unknown sources.

Roblox recommends enabling 2FA to protect your account from unauthorized access. This simple step can significantly reduce the risk of account hacks and phishing attempts.

Examples of Scams and Phishing Attempts Related to Roblox Redeem Codes

Scammers often employ various tactics to trick Roblox players into redeeming codes on their accounts. Some common tricks include:

  • Phishing emails or messages that mimic Roblox’s official email or chat system.
  • Fake websites that promise exclusive items or bonuses for redeeming specific codes.
  • Malicious apps or software that claim to generate or verify Roblox redeem codes.

Roblox provides a clear guide on identifying phishing attempts: “Be cautious of messages that ask you to click on links or download attachments from unknown sources. Legitimate Roblox messages will never ask you to download software or click on suspicious links.”When you encounter a suspicious email or message, report it to Roblox’s official support team immediately. This will help prevent potential scams and protect other players’ accounts.
